Transaction 296e04612587a5a66961ed145b262b57ce4faeee7447f1c0b3cc810f8640f1c4
1 Input
1 Output
-
296e04612587a5a66961ed145b262b57ce4faeee7447f1c0b3cc810f8640f1c4:0
- value
- 1050500
- script pubkey
- OP_0 OP_PUSHBYTES_20 fab66579eb8f11734999d8f1ae7127dd4140f636
- address
- bc1ql2mx270t3ughxjvemrc6uuf8m4q5pa3k6w58fv